84-year old loses age discrimination claim
Email this article ... Printer friendly version ... Export to text document ...
06 July 2007

An 84-year old cleaner who was sacked for being too old has lost his unfair dismissal claim, which could have implications for thousands of elderly workers.

Bernard Lloyd-Briden, who worked at Worthing College, was sacked because the college's insurance company would not cover someone so old.

 

An employment tribunal dismissed his unfair dismissal claim on the basis that he was over 65 and was not entitled to bring the claim. A High Court judge upheld the decision, even though the legal provisions under which his claim was struck out have since been repealed.

 

The college had successfully argued that the provisions of the Employment Rights Act - which stipulate that workers have a right not to be unfairly dismissed - did not apply to Mr Lloyd-Briden because he was over 65. Mr Lloyd-Briden appealed on the grounds of age discrimination.

 

Mr Justice Wilkie ruled that the provisions relating to the rights of over 65s have now been repealed in line with an EU directive, but said that did not happen until after Mr Lloyd-Briden's claim had been struck out.
